Output ec95401a915ac3099893e8adcb8d98ab8f3396c255c38f0a771cb18725a408ef:32

value
63695000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2f30e0aefdc4405c51b933031937386c5cfbf6 OP_EQUAL
address
3BTkkxDThYmaykKy1mGbT6dCvWrHemD2f3
transaction
ec95401a915ac3099893e8adcb8d98ab8f3396c255c38f0a771cb18725a408ef
spent
true